    I just updated to the 0812 bios however, my settings seem incorrect. CPUZ shows that my CPU (E6600 on P5k DLX) is running at 1603 MHZ. For now I want to get it to be stable at STOCK speeds, and I will worry about overlocks later.

    Can you provide BIOS settings for complete stock operation? My ram is 4-4-4-12 Corsair XMS PC6400. Thanks!

    Disable EIST and co again in the CPU feature... 6 x 266 is about 1600mhz... or start prime or such and you will see that it will go up to 9 multi and show 2400mhz...

    FSB is nice but doesn't mean ya CPU can breach 4ghz unless you whack insane voltages coupled with extreme cooling

    Newer E8400 Wolfdales top out around 4-4.2Ghz stable at reasonable voltage levels (sub 1.4Vcore) for most users... while they can breach 550FSB doesn't mean they can go up to 4.5ghz and higher stable... Sell that E6850 and go wolfdale it will make life easier on ya...

    Interesting! PM me or post what else you set because I know it's about luck of the draw, but I havent come accross a E6850 that cant do 500FSB @ 500x8 in 1:1, so I should think 450x9 is much easier except if on certain dividers.

    Every E6750 I messed with can do it but with still less vcore then you posted. Again, luck of the drwa. I would suspect BIOS BETA version and settings, as all the non BETA up to v0802 did fine. Shouldn't need more then 1.55v as 500x8 and no more then 1.632 PLL and 1.472v FSBT w/ 63% GTL.
